FAQs for finding home care in Hanover Park, IL
How much does private home care cost per hour near me in Hanover Park, IL?
The average rate for hiring a home care provider in Hanover Park, IL as of April, 2025 is $24.38 per hour. This cost will fluctuate depending on the provider's level of experience, whether the care is full-time or part-time and the duties required to perform to care for your senior loved one.

What types of home care services are available near me in Hanover Park, IL?
The types of home health care services near you in Hanover Park, IL will vary depending on the needs of the senior you’re hiring home care assistance for, but home care providers can assist with companionship and fellowship, as well as skilled nursing care. There are also home caregivers in Hanover Park, IL that can assist with daily activities, such as cooking, medication prompting, dressing, bathing and transporting the senior patient to and from appointments.

What interview questions should I ask when hiring home health care near me in Hanover Park, IL?
When you’re hiring in home health care services near you in Hanover Park, IL, it can be really helpful to interview a handful of different candidates to help you find the right fit. It’s a good idea to ask them questions about the exact responsibilities they feel comfortable taking on, how they best communicate, and what types of senior health issues they have dealt with in the past.
